“Will anyone buy that?”

This is a question that comes up frequently when I talk to new clients about their core offer.

See, deep down, most of us do know what value we really want to offer to others.  If we’re courageous enough to go into our hearts and have a good look around, we know we want to help others with their relationships, or with their intuitive development, or with the organization of their closets, or with their optimal nutrition.  We know.

And we also know how we would most love to deliver that value – whether that’s through private in-person sessions, or mastermind groups, or digital products, or teleclasses, or continuity programs.

The possibilities are endless … but if we get totally honest with ourselves, we DO know what we want to offer, and in what format.

So why aren’t we getting on with it?

Most of the time, it’s because of that question. “Will anyone buy that?”

On the surface, this question is about whether we can truly make a living doing that thing that’s in our hearts.

It’s a terribly disempowering question.  Too many entrepreneurs base their business not on what’s authentically in their hearts, but on what they think people will buy.

The problem is that we can’t possibly know what people will buy.  And by basing our business on our perception of other people’s opinions, we take ourselves out of our purpose, out of our authenticity, and out of everything that makes abundance truly flow.

“Will anyone buy that?” is the wrong question to ask.

If you communicate the value of what you offer effectively … then OF COURSE someone will buy what you’re offering.

If we dig a little deeper, we find that this question “Will anyone buy that?” is not a money question at all.

Dig a little deeper, and you’ll find that the real question is: “If I put my heart and soul on a silver platter for all the world to see … if I put what’s most precious to me, my innate value, my passion, my purpose, and offer it to the world … what if the world doesn’t think I’m valuable?”

There’s a deeper reason we don’t offer the products and services that are really in our hearts.  We’re terrified of rejection.  We don’t want the Universe to break our hearts.  We don’t want, under any circumstances, to have that secret vision we have of our sacred, purposeful value negated.

It feels far safer to default to products and services that seem more “sellable” or that seem like they have a “proven” track record.  Unfortunately, for highly conscious entrepreneurs, the key to abundance is standing in our authentic self-expression.  By basing our business on anything other than what is truly authentic, we actually hinder the flow of money … and what we most fear becomes a reality.  No-one buys our “stuff.”  But that’s because it’s not really our authentic, purposeful “stuff.”
